📋Overview
This practice within alternative medicine relies on manual muscle testing to assess the body's physiological state. Practitioners of this method observe how specific muscles respond to physical pressure, interpreting the strength or weakness of these responses as indicators of internal health or functional imbalances.
The approach is based on the concept that the musculoskeletal system reflects the status of other internal systems. While it is often used in conjunction with various health assessments, it remains a distinct diagnostic framework separate from conventional medical testing and is not a substance or dietary supplement.
